
Cost of Garage Foundation Building in Colorado Springs
Building a garage foundation in Colorado Springs, CO, involves various considerations and costs that homeowners should be aware of. The unique climate, soil conditions, and local regulations all play a role in determining the overall expense. Understanding these factors can help you budget more accurately for your project.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Condition: The type of soil can influence the foundation's complexity and cost.
- Foundation Type: Options like slab, crawl space, or full basement vary in price.
- Size of the Garage: Larger garages require more materials and labor.
- Material Costs: Prices for concrete, rebar, and other materials can fluctuate.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s in Colorado Springs can affect the total expense.
- Permits and Inspections: Fees for local permits and required inspections add to the cost.
- Site Preparation: Clearing and leveling the site can vary in complexity and expense.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can impact the timeline and c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Soil Testing | $500 - $1,000 |
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Concrete Slab Foundation | $4,000 - $8,000 |
Crawl Space Foundation | $8,000 - $15,000 |
Full Basement Foundation | $15,000 - $30,000 |
Rebar Installation | $500 - $2,000 |
Permits and Inspections | $500 - $1,500 |
Labor (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
